PROBABLE CAUSES
Incorrect electrode gap of spark plug
Spark plug thermal gradation wrong
Ignition unit defective
Incorrect carburetor main jet (incorrect setting)
Incorrect fuel level
Air filter element obstructed
Excess of carbon deposits
Incorrect oil level
Incorrect oil viscosity
Incorrect oil gradation
Pads fail to return freely (remains blocked)
